Job Description

We are seeking a highly skilled and hands-on Mechanical Engineer with a deep specialisation in manufacturing and production. This is a full-time, on-site role in Mumbai, Maharashtra, India, focused on the heart of our operations: the transformation of raw materials into finished, precision-machined components for the demanding mining and drilling industry.

 

This is not a theoretical design role. You will be the critical link between the engineering design and the production floor, ensuring our products can be manufactured efficiently, repeatably, and to the highest quality standards. Your day-to-day work will involve optimising production processes, troubleshooting manufacturing challenges, and driving continuous improvement in our machining operations.

Responsibilities

  • Create and analyse product designs, providing critical feedback to ensure they are optimised for CNC machining, production, assembly, safety and cost-effectiveness.
  • Develop, document, and refine manufacturing processes for metal components, including CNC milling, turning, grinding, and heat treatment.
  • Oversee and support CAM programming, select appropriate cutting tools, and establish optimal machining parameters (feeds, speeds, depths of cut) for various hard metals and alloys.
  • Establish in-process inspection points, interpret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ing specifications, and resolve any quality deviations.
  • Act as a primary technical resource for the production team, troubleshooting machining issues, resolving bottlenecks, and implementing corrective actions.
  • Liaise with material suppliers on technical specifications and contribute to the selection and testing of new materials and coatings.


Qualifications

  • Bachelor's Degree in Mechanical Engineering, Manufacturing Engineering, or a related field.
  • Demonstrable, hands-on experience in a metal machining production environment (e.g., CNC machine shop, component manufacturing).
  • Strong proficiency in 3D CAD software, with a preference for SolidWorks.
  • Practical understanding of CNC machining processes, G-code, and CAM software.
  • Experience with the metallurgy of steels and alloys used in high-wear applications, including knowledge of heat treatment processes.
  • Excellent analytical and data-driven problem-solving skills.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ills in both Hindi and English.
